Danny got the opportunity of a lifetime; after three years of internship, part-time work, and living in 15 by 15 room with a toilet and a shower behind a curtain, he had the opportunity to interview with the Altamont Company, which had been his dream since he was ten years old. The interview is seven days from now, and Danny is determined to study it all ten times; he's not going to miss this chance. As the week goes by, insane things keep happening to him, an older man is having trouble breathing in a coffee shop, and no one's helping him; Danny steps in. He becomes locked in an elevator with three other people, a woman starts to panic, and no one knows what to do; Danny has to take charge of the situation to get the group out. A neighbor comes across the hall in a panic, saying he's been hacked, and that the hackers are threatening to kidnap his children. The neighbor who can't have any suspicion of negligence can't call the police, or he'll lose his children anyway. He knows Danny is good at computers; Danny reluctantly checks it out and finds he's being scammed after two hours of work. A spy from Altamont's rival contacts him and says he'll pay a million dollars if he wears a hidden camera to his interview. On his way to the interview, knowing that he barely had enough time to look at stuff once, never mind the ten times he wanted, continually runs into issues keeping him from getting there on time, a bad car crash, a closed road, a police crime scene, but through determination he finally arrives on time. He eventually arrives in the waiting room, and 50 people are waiting; while sitting in the crowded, hot, and with no cell or wifi signal, he sees an innovative way to get his interview first, but a woman starts crying and sitting next to him. He begins to recognize faces from the week in the waiting room; he's been interviewing for the whole week. He begins to doubt himself, should he take the chance, get his interview before everyone else, or fix a room slowly devolving into chaos.
